Sophie Janna and Margot Merah met during music sessions in the Amsterdam Irish pub ‘Mulligans’. Someone proposed they should sing together during a jam. It turned out their voices sounded very good together, and from that moment they became ‘The Lasses’. They accompany themselves on guitar, bodhran (Irish hand-held drum) and sometimes on harmonica. They have an enormous amount of songs. Stories about love, death, and other things about life are performed with humour, musicality and without pretence. The Irish and American folk traditions clearly influenced them in their song choices and their own work.

photo: Bram Heeren

 

The Lasses cover songs from the Celtic-British and American oeuvre, but they also perform their own songs. The self-titled debut and the second album, ‘Daughters, ‘ only feature covers from other songs. Their third album features live recordings, recorded in the Parel van Zuilen in Utrecht.
